Styles of Beyond were an underground hip hop group from the San Fernando Valley of Los Angeles, California. The group consisted of MCs Ryan Patrick Maginn (Ryu) and Takbir Bashir (Tak), Colton Raisin Fisher (DJ Cheapshot), and producer Jason Rabinowitz (Vin Skully). They have released two LPs, one mixtape and were heavily featured on Mike Shinoda's Fort Minor project in 2005. At one point they were also signed to Shinoda's Machine Shop Recordings label, although they left the label in late 2008. They are also heavily associated with the underground rap group Demigodz which features similar underground artists such as Apathy, Celph Titled, and 7L & Esoteric. After doing a few shows in 2013, the group split to work on their solo careers, with Ryu continuing to work with the Demigodz. | Net Worth | $1.5 Million |
